与本地C++的Web浏览器通信 我有一个CPU处理的图像处理应用程序,它是用C++开发的,图像是实时从网络摄像头中获取的。这个应用程序应该在客户端运行。p> 我想启动、暂停、传输数据,并通过Web浏览器退出C++应用程序。 所以基本上,我的用户界面将是客户端的HTML+Javascript

与本地C++的Web浏览器通信 我有一个CPU处理的图像处理应用程序,它是用C++开发的,图像是实时从网络摄像头中获取的。这个应用程序应该在客户端运行。p> 我想启动、暂停、传输数据,并通过Web浏览器退出C++应用程序。 所以基本上,我的用户界面将是客户端的HTML+Javascript,javascript,c++,html,browser,Javascript,C++,Html,Browser,我不想使用NPAPI作为我的主要目标浏览器是G.Chrome,它正在逐步淘汰。 我不能使用本机客户端,因为它不支持访问网络摄像头,因为沙箱问题 在同一台机器上有C++和JS的通信方式吗? 我很满意windows解决方案。。。 理想的解决方案是多浏览器解决方案,如chrome、firefox、ie 非常感谢,对于Windows+IE,只有您可以编译为ActiveX控件 对于多浏览器,需要在JS中重新编码(这不是一个小问题),或者将图像发送到web服务器(Nodejs可以做到这一点),并且您需要在那

我不想使用NPAPI作为我的主要目标浏览器是G.Chrome,它正在逐步淘汰。 我不能使用本机客户端,因为它不支持访问网络摄像头,因为沙箱问题

<>在同一台机器上有C++和JS的通信方式吗? 我很满意windows解决方案。。。 理想的解决方案是多浏览器解决方案,如chrome、firefox、ie


非常感谢,对于Windows+IE,只有您可以编译为ActiveX控件

对于多浏览器,需要在JS中重新编码(这不是一个小问题),或者将图像发送到web服务器(Nodejs可以做到这一点),并且您需要在那里进行处理


不知道您对图像所做的操作将决定上述解决方案的可行性。

我认为您可以通过从javascript录制并将数据传递到本机客户端来实现


查看如何从javascript录制。

您所说的本机客户端是什么意思?沙箱问题是什么?为什么它不能访问网络摄像头?至于问题:如果不创建扩展就不可能。是否要发送图像流?或嵌入铬:?